Funnel Cake Fries with Marshmallow Fluff Dip: A Sweet Snack Delight
Funnel cake fries are a playful twist on the traditional funnel cake, delivering the same delicious flavor in a fun, dippable form. Served with a creamy marshmallow fluff dip, these treats combine the warm, crispy texture of funnel cakes with the sweet, gooey goodness of marshmallow, making them irresistible. This recipe is perfect for a festive gathering, a family fun night, or whenever you’re in the mood for something sweet and a little different.

- Preparation time: 15 minutes
- Cooking time: 1-2 minutes per batch
- Serving size: Serves 4-6
- Equipment: Large pot, mixer, piping bag or bottle, thermometer
Recipe Title: Funnel Cake Fries with Marshmallow Fluff Dip
Ingredients:
For the Funnel Cake Fries:
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 2 eggs
- 1/4 cup white sugar
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 3-4 cups canola or vegetable oil (for frying)
For the Marshmallow Fluff Dip:
- 1 jar marshmallow creme or fluff
Directions:
- Prepare the Batter:
- In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t. Set aside.
- In a large bowl, use a mixer to beat the eggs, sugar, milk, and vanilla until the mixture is foamy and well combined.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until you have a smooth, thick batter.
- Pipe and Fry:
- Fill a piping bag or a squeeze bottle with the batter.
- Heat about 1 inch of oil in a large pot with high sides to 350 degrees F. Use a thermometer to ensure the temperature is correct.
- Carefully pipe the batter in long, straight lines into the hot oil. Fry until each piece is golden brown, about 30-60 seconds per side.
- Remove the funnel cake fries with a slotted spoon and drain on paper towels.
- Prepare the Marshmallow Fluff Dip:
- Place the marshmallow creme in a microwave-safe bowl. Warm in the microwave for 15-20 seconds, then stir until smooth.
- Serve:
- Serve the warm funnel cake fries with the marshmallow fluff dip on the side. For an extra touch of sweetness, sprinkle powdered sugar over the fries just before serving.
To Reheat:
- If you have leftovers, reheat the funnel cake fries by placing them on a baking sheet and baking at 450 degrees F for about 3 minutes, or until crispy.
